France to Establish New Maximum Security Prison in Guyana: Darmanin Unveils Plans Amidst Rising Security Concerns

In a decisive move to bolster France’s correctional infrastructure, Interior Minister Gérald Darmanin has announced the construction of a new maximum security prison in Guyana. This initiative, aimed at addressing the pressing issues of prison overcrowding and escalating crime rates, is set to enhance the nation’s capacity to manage high-risk inmates. The announcement comes at a time when security concerns are at the forefront of national discourse, prompting calls for more robust measures to ensure public safety. The new facility will serve as a crucial component of the French government’s broader strategy to reform the penal system and mitigate the challenges posed by a growing population of violent offenders. As officials outline the logistical and financial aspects of this ambitious project, the implications for both local communities and the broader landscape of France’s criminal justice system remain the subject of intense discussion.

France’s New Maximum Security Prison in Guyana Aimed at Combating Crime and Improving Incarceration Conditions

In a significant move to address the issues surrounding crime and overcrowding in the penal system, French Interior Minister Gérald Darmanin has announced plans for a new maximum security prison in French Guiana. This facility is envisioned as a state-of-the-art institution that will enhance security measures to prevent escapes and improve living conditions for inmates. The initiative is part of the French government’s broader strategy to combat crime in the region, which has been plagued by drug trafficking and gang violence. This investment underscores a commitment to modernizing incarceration methods while ensuring that facilities adhere to international human rights standards.

The forthcoming prison will not only focus on security but also aims to rehabilitate offenders and reduce recidivism rates. To achieve this, the design will incorporate several key elements, including:

  • Vocational Training Programs: Providing inmates with skills to reintegrate into society.
  • Psychological Support: Offering counseling services to address mental health issues.
  • Modern Living Conditions: Ensuring humane treatment in a secure environment.

This strategic development is expected to create local jobs and contribute to the economy of French Guiana while enhancing public safety across the nation. With this new approach, the government hopes to set a precedent in effective prison management and social reintegration efforts.
